Dolby Laboratories dominates the premium audio technology space with an estimated 28% market share in cinema audio and 35% in streaming content. The company's technologies power experiences across cinemas, homes, cars, and mobile devices worldwide.
Beyond their core audio business, Dolby has expanded into imaging with Dolby Vision, which now features in over 1,000 film and TV titles annually. Their recent acquisition of GE Licensing added 5,000+ patents to their portfolio, significantly boosting future licensing revenue potential.
